The Week: Media news - Guardian users top 25m
Campaign, Friday, 28 November 2008, 12:00am,
The Guardian's website has broken the 25 million barrier for the first time, with 25,976,046 unique users in October.
ABCe results revealed that Guardian Unlimited's audience was now 74 times larger than the paper's print circulation. It credited the coverage of the US election, hourly reports on the "Sachsgate" saga and the financial downturn for the growth in October. It is also the first time a UK newspaper's site has had more than ten million UK users.
